Definitions related to microradiography:
  • Process by which a radiograph of a small or very thin object is produced on photographic film under conditions permitting subsequent microscopic examination or high resolution enlargement of the radiograph.
    CRISP Thesaurus
    National Institutes of Health, 2006
  • Production of a radiographic image of a small or very thin object on fine-grained photographic film under conditions which permit subsequent microscopic examination or enlargement of the radiograph at linear magnifications of up to several hundred and with a resolution approaching the resolving power of the photographic emulsion (about 1000 lines per millimeter).
